How to Explain Tinnitus to a Doctor
Tinnitus, often described as a ringing, buzzing, or humming sound in the ears, can have a significant impact on one’s quality of life. When discussing your tinnitus with a doctor, it is crucial to educate them on the profound effects it can have on your well-being. Share how the constant noise can lead to sleep disturbances, increased stress levels, and difficulty concentrating. By providing this insight, you can help your doctor better understand the urgency of addressing your tinnitus symptoms.
In addition to educating your doctor on the impact of tinnitus, it is essential to provide detailed descriptions of your specific symptoms. Be sure to communicate the frequency and intensity of the sounds you hear, as well as any factors that may exacerbate or alleviate the ringing in your ears. By painting a clear picture of your tinnitus experience, you can assist your doctor in formulating an accurate diagnosis and developing an appropriate treatment plan tailored to your needs.
